Trump Asks Supreme Court to Allow White House Ballroom Construction to Continue

REUTERS—President Donald Trump’s administration on Friday asked the Supreme Court to allow it to continue construction of his $400 million White House ballroom after an appeals court ruled the project lacked the necessary approval from Congress.

The Trump administration asked the justices to keep the ruling by the U.S.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ia Circuit on hold while it prepares a full appeal to the Supreme Court.

Justice Department lawyers, in their filing, echoed Trump’s contention that the ballroom project is a security necessity. Citing numerous assassination attempts against Trump, lawyers described the project as “vitally required by national security.”    

“This case involves an extraordinary and unlawful injunction that will halt the ongoing construction of the integrated military complex, including a totally secure ballroom space, at the East Wing of the White House, which is vitally required by national security,” they wrote.

The D.C. Circuit, in a 2-1 ruling on Aug. 7, upheld a lower-court judge’s order directing the administration to halt above-ground construction.

“Whether or not a massive ballroom should be constructed is for Congress to decide and is not a matter for Executive self-help,” the panel wrote. 

The appeals court had paused its order from taking effect for 14 days to allow the Trump administration to challenge it at the Supreme Court.

The National Trust for Historic Preservation brought the case last year after the administration tore down the East Wing and began building a 90,000-square-foot ballroom without seeking authorization from Congress.

The National Trust did not immediately respond to a request for comment.

Trump has said the ballroom project is a security necessity, and referred to the structure as a “military center” in a post on Truth Social earlier this month. He called the D.C. Circuit’s decision “horrendous” and politically motivated and said it left him, other White House officials, and visitors exposed to attack.

“This unjust decision must be overturned by the Supreme Court in its entirety,” Trump wrote. He said the ballroom plan includes bomb shelters, medical facilities, shielding from drones and missiles and other security features that are “all tied together as one big, expensive, and very complex unit.”

The D.C. Circuit’s opinion said national security arguments “are not an automatic get-out-of-law-free card.”

The appeals court’s order did not permanently bar construction of a ballroom, but blocked above-ground efforts until the administration secures approval from Congress.
